Introduction Additive manufacturing (AM) technology seems to offer significant opportunities to meet the demands of space flight, as it helps save materials, reduce transport weight, and shorten production time. Additionally, it supports the use of recycled materials or materials collected directly on-site, known as in-situ resource utilization (ISRU). Over the past decade, NASA and space … Read more
